Output 06696d211504587de327d2a3d67fa29bcab8920eb858e527ee4b6500da011340:1

value
34256847482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fb13cf8120a67121c3dd1f528e5442bd5a00797 OP_EQUAL
address
34abCDMMNWHXLj4JNMLJb6J8gAtjpBuPsq
transaction
06696d211504587de327d2a3d67fa29bcab8920eb858e527ee4b6500da011340
confirmations
347126
spent
true